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[php]Wyciąganie tekstu z pomiędzy dwuch znaczników, Wyrażenia regularne
aki00
post
Post #1





Grupa: Zarejestrowani
Postów: 15
Pomógł: 0
Dołączył: 6.06.2006
Skąd: Z tamtąd xD

Ostrzeżenie: (0%)
-----


Witam mam problem z wyciągnięciem tekstu z pomiędzy dwóch znaczników. Znalazłem podobny temat już na forum i przerobiłem go sobie lecz nadal nie działa.

Chciałbym aby tekst był wyciągany ze znaczników komentarzy HTML np:

  1. adssdas dsadsaads dasads <!-- pobierz:start --> tekst d wyciagniecia <!-- pobierz:koniec --> asdasdasd


A oto kod PHP

  1. <?php
  2. $string = "adssdas dsadsaads dasads <!-- pobierz:start --> tekst d wyciagniecia <!-- pobierz:koniec --> asdasdasd";
  3. echo preg_replace("/(<!-- pobierz:start -->)(.*?)(<!-- pobierzt:koniec -->)/", '$1', $string);
  4. ?>


Z góry dzięki za pomoc.

Ten post edytował aki00 14.04.2008, 19:14:41
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
nevt
post
Post #2





Grupa: Przyjaciele php.pl
Postów: 1 595
Pomógł: 282
Dołączył: 24.09.2007
Skąd: Reda, Pomorskie.

Ostrzeżenie: (0%)
-----


proszę poprawić temat na zgodny z zasadami publikacji w Przedszkolu (brakuje taga)!

przeczytaj w manualu opis funkcji preg_match_all() i rozdział poświęcony zmiennym tablicowym ...
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 25.12.2025 - 23:53